Immersive Storytelling: Beyond the Fold

Forget static images and blocks of text. 2025 demands immersive storytelling. Think interactive animations, subtle parallax scrolling that reveals your brand narrative as users explore, and integrated video experiences. The goal is to draw users into your world from the moment they land on your page. Short, looping video backgrounds, strategically placed micro-interactions, and dynamic content loading all contribute to a more engaging and memorable experience. This approach necessitates careful planning of the user journey and a deep understanding of your target audience.

Personalization at Scale: Tailoring the Experience

Generic experiences are fading. Data-driven personalization is the future. In 2025, expect even more sophisticated AI-powered solutions that adapt the homepage content based on user behavior, demographics, and past interactions. Welcome returning customers with tailored product recommendations. Showcase relevant blog posts based on their interests. Offer personalized promotions to new visitors. Micro-Interactions & Delightful Details: The Power of Small Touches

Small details can make a big difference. Micro-interactions – subtle animations, hover effects, and visual cues – add a layer of polish and sophistication to the user experience. A simple button animation, a color change on hover, or a progress bar can all contribute to a more engaging and intuitive experience. These small details not only make your website more enjoyable to use but also communicate attention to detail and professionalism. Accessibility First: Design for Everyone

Accessibility is no longer optional; it’s a fundamental requirement. In 2025, prioritize inclusive design practices that ensure your homepage is usable by people of all abilities. This includes proper use of ARIA attributes, semantic HTML, sufficient color contrast, and keyboard navigation. Not only is it the right thing to do, but it also expands your reach and improves your SEO. Tools like the Accessibility Insights browser extension can help identify and address accessibility issues.

Bold Typography & Creative Layouts: Visual Hierarchy Reinvented

Typography plays a crucial role in conveying your brand message and creating visual impact. In 2025, expect to see more experimentation with bold fonts, unusual letter spacing, and dynamic typography animations. Coupled with creative grid layouts that break away from traditional structures, these techniques can help you create a homepage that stands out from the crowd. Think asymmetrical designs, overlapping elements, and unexpected image placements. However, remember to prioritize readability and user experience above all else.

Simplified Navigation: Guiding the User Journey

While visual innovation is important, never compromise on usability. Clear and intuitive navigation is essential for guiding users through your website and helping them find what they’re looking for. In 2025, expect to see a continued focus on simplified navigation menus, prominent search bars, and clear calls to action. Consider using sticky navigation, mega menus, and breadcrumb trails to enhance the user experience. Conduct user testing to ensure your navigation is intuitive and easy to use.

Performance Optimization: Speed as a Core Design Principle

A visually stunning homepage is useless if it takes forever to load. Website speed is a critical factor in user experience and SEO. In 2025, performance optimization should be a core design principle. Optimize images, minify code, leverage browser caching, and choose a reliable hosting provider. Tools like Google PageSpeed Insights can help you identify areas for improvement. Remember, every second counts.
